The Proteas have arrived in Potchefstroom at their happy hunting ground of Senwes Park, geared up and ready for tomorrow’s third ODI against Australia.
South Africa will be looking for a 3-0 whitewash in front of an expectant home crowd.
Captain, Quinton de Kock, asserted the fact that the Proteas have played good and aggressive cricket this series.
“We have worked really hard to come up with another win. It would be good to come up with a 3-0 win on Saturday.”
“We we’re pretty good with everything in the last game, but in saying that we’ve played pretty well these last two games. It’s just a matter of maintaining the standards you have set.”
De Kock was also impressed with the crowds this series and expects Potch crowds to come out in their numbers.
“It’s good to see everyone coming out to support us. It makes us proud to know what we are representing,” he stated.
